Today we will discuss VSEPR (pronounced “vesper”), which stands for valence-shell electron-pair repulsion. The basis of VSEPR is that the electrons in bonds and lone pairs repel each other. To minimize the instability that results from these repulsions, a molecule will adopt the shape that places electron groups as far apart as possible. VSEPR ...

A very important concept when it comes to thinking about markets in economics is the idea of Pareto efficiency. An allocation of resources is Pareto efficient if it is not possible to make anyone better off without making someone else worse off.

What determines blood type? Contained within their cell membranes, some red blood cells have special glycolipids called A and B glycolipids. People with blood type A have the A glycolipid in their cell membranes, people with blood type B have the B glycolipid in their cell membranes, and people with blood type AB, have both glycolipids in their ...
